TOML-formaterer
Inndata
Utdata
Tekniske detaljer
Slik fungerer TOML-formatereren
Hva verktøyet gjør
TOML-formatereren beautifier og formaterer TOML-konfigurasjonsfiler (Tom's Obvious, Minimal Language), slik at de blir mer lesbare og konsistente. Denne toml formatereren bruker Prettier med prettier-plugin-toml for å sikre riktig formatering i henhold til TOML-standardene. Når du trenger å formatere toml-filer, rydde opp i konfigurasjonsfiler eller sikre konsistent innrykk og struktur, gir dette verktøyet pålitelige formateringsmuligheter. Toml prettifier håndterer komplekse TOML-strukturer, inkludert tabeller, arrayer, inline-tabeller og nestede konfigurasjoner, samtidig som den opprettholder gyldig TOML-syntaks.
Vanlige bruksområder for utviklere
Utviklere bruker TOML-formaterere når de jobber med konfigurasjonsfiler for prosjekter som Rusts Cargo.toml, Pythons pyproject.toml eller ulike applikasjonskonfigurasjoner. Funksjonaliteten toml formatter online er viktig når man rydder opp i manuelt redigerte konfigurasjonsfiler, sikrer konsistent formatering på tvers av teammedlemmer eller forbereder konfigurasjonsfiler for versjonskontroll. Mange utviklere trenger å formatere toml når de migrerer fra andre konfigurasjonsformater, standardiserer prosjektkonfigurasjoner eller feilsøker syntaksproblemer i konfigurasjonen. Toml beautifier hjelper ved arbeid med pakkebehandlere, byggeverktøy eller ethvert system som bruker TOML til konfigurasjon. TOML-formatering er verdifullt for å opprettholde lesbare og vedlikeholdbare konfigurasjonsfiler i moderne utviklingsarbeidsflyter.
Nøkkelfunksjoner
- Prettier-integrasjon:Bruker Prettier med prettier-plugin-toml for bransjestandard formatering
- Konfigurerbart innrykk:Velg mellom 2 mellomrom, 4 mellomrom eller tabulatorer for innrykk
- Sanntidsformatering:Se formatert output mens du skriver med automatiske oppdateringer
- Minifisering:Mulighet for å minifisere TOML ved å fjerne unødvendige mellomrom
- Syntaksvalidering:Identifiserer og rapporterer TOML-syntaksfeil under formatering